Over the past two months, a volunteer leadership committee was formed at EllisDon, known as Community CommittED. The team is led by Chris Royer, Chelsea Byrgesen, Justin Hantos and Morgan Kiefer and is in place to support EllisDon Calgary to further build, support and empower the communities we live, work and play in. Current community initiatives being organized by the team include Plaid for Dad for Prostate Cancer, Foothills Medical Centre Frontline Workers Plaza Renovation, and the development and construction of multiple skating rinks in partnership with Elladj Baldé, former Canadian professional figure skater, in some of Calgary’s underdeveloped neighbourhoods. Through initiatives likes these, our Vision is to connect EllisDon staff with the people and organizations within our communities to build strong connections and provide support to those that need it most.
